Japanese confectionery brand C³ (Sea Cube) — known for its focus on the three "C"s of Coffee, Cacao, and Cheese — has launched a summer-limited new item: "Baked Tiramisu Sio." Drawing on the widely discussed "salt coffee" trend, the product is now on sale at C³ stores nationwide and the Suzette official online shop, starting April 25, 2026.
A Baked Tiramisu Inspired by the "Salt Coffee" Trend
The practice of adding a pinch of salt to coffee has been gaining popularity across Asia, said to accentuate sweetness and bring depth to the flavor. C³ has translated this concept into their signature baked tiramisu for the summer season.
The coffee used is 100% Ethiopian Mocha beans (1% Ethiopian Mocha coffee in the coffee syrup), prized for their fruity aroma and gentle acidity — delivering a light and refreshing taste suited to the summer heat. A pinch of natural rock salt, rich in mineral-derived umami, is added to draw out the sweetness and enhance the coffee flavor while leaving a clean, refreshing finish. The surface is finished in a pale white tone to evoke a fresh, summery feel.
Chilling the product before eating is also recommended, making it an ideal pairing with iced coffee on hot days.
The packaging design uses light blue to suggest salt and summer, combined with the red, green, and yellow of the Ethiopian flag, for a lively and cheerful look. Triangular and diamond shapes embedded in the design subtly reference salt crystals and mountains of rock salt.

C³'s Signature "Baked Tiramisu" — Triple Award Winner

A beloved staple since C³'s founding, the Baked Tiramisu expresses the classic tiramisu flavor in baked form through an exclusive recipe by a world-class pastry chef (winner of the Coupe du Monde de la Pâtisserie 2023). The moist cake is infused with coffee flavor and balanced by the rich, slightly bitter character of cheese — making it the brand's defining long-selling product.
The recipe uses domestically produced mascarpone from Hamanaka Town, Hokkaido — the same variety used in the fresh tiramisu — and involves a dedicated machine that slowly soaks coffee sauce into the cake immediately after baking. This combination of premium ingredients and careful craftsmanship has earned the product loyal fans both in Japan and abroad.
